Soybean Agglutinin Background
Soybean agglutinin is a type of lectin protein found in soybeans. Lectins are proteins that can bind specifically to certain carbohydrate structures. Soybean agglutinin, in particular, has an affinity for specific carbohydrates, and its binding properties have been studied in various contexts.
Here are a few key points about soybean agglutinin:
- Binding Properties: It has an affinity for certain carbohydrate structures, allowing it to bind to specific sugar molecules present on cell surfaces or other glycoproteins.
- Biological Research: Soybean agglutinin has been of interest in biological and biomedical research due to its ability to interact with cell surfaces. Researchers often use it as a tool to study cell biology, cell surface interactions, and glycosylation patterns.
- Potential Health Implications: Some studies have explored the potential effects of soybean agglutinin on health, particularly concerning its interactions with the digestive system or its potential impact in allergic reactions related to soy consumption. However, more research is needed in this area.
- Food Analysis: In the food industry, soybean agglutinin may be a focus of analysis in food safety assessments, especially regarding soybean-derived products. Its detection and quantification can be crucial for individuals with soy-related allergies.
- Plant Biology: Researchers studying plant biology may investigate the presence and distribution of lectins like soybean agglutinin in different soybean varieties or in response to environmental conditions.
